Quote:
It's a good day. Play all day, take a lunch break (a nice buffet style like you will get at the resort) then rest in one of the many hammocks. Then go to the night show. I would wait and book there so you can make sure the weather cooperates. Not a fun day if it's chilly and rainy. It's pretty close to the Barcelo so a cab and park tickets (skip the meal option and buy food at the snack bars) would be the cheaper option. It's nice to have your transpo and everything in the tour package prearranged though. Either way, it's a great place to visit. You will have a great time. |
